1.8 Functionality
The air quality is detected by KWL-VOC eC (mixed gas sensor for volatile organic
substances). This sensor determines the loading of the room air due to contami-
nated gases such as cigarette smoke, body perspiration, exhaled breathing air,
solvent vapours, emissions, etc.

The recommended installation height for the room sensor KWL-VOC eC is between
1.4 and 1.5 m, persons who are usually standing and sitting are considered equally
at this height.
The room sensor KWL-VOC eC can also be installed at a different height if the specific
spatial conditions do not allow the recommended installation height.
